Qiyshown
Qiyshown {kee-shone'}
Hebrew: personal noun location
Possible Definitions:
Kishon = "winding"
1) a river in central Palestine; scene of the defeat of Sisera by the Israelites in the time of the judges and the destruction of
the prophets of Baal by Elijah
